A hand grenade can be incredibly handy in an emergency situation. You pull the pin, throw it, and four seconds later it explodes. Let's take a look at how it works.
There are four basic parts to the grenade. There's the pin, which holds the handle on, the handle itself, the fuse, which consists of a heavy metal shell with explosives inside.
Technically the pin doesn't do anything. It's just holding the handle in place. This handle, however, is key. Once it comes off, the grenade is armed and there's no turning back. With the pin removed, the only thing holding the handle on is your hand. Once you throw the grenade, the handle flies off. That releases a spring that throws the striker down into the percussion cap. The impact ignites the cap creating a small spark. The spark ignites a slow burning material inside the fuse. the fuse ignites the detonator which sends off a small explosion inside the grenade.
The detonators explosion lights the main explosive charge inside the grenade, and that blows it apart. Flying metal fragments from the heavy metal casing are what do the damage. So that's how a grenade works.

It depends on what kind of grenade it is. The M26 and M26A1 grenades are 21 oz (595 g). The M61 grenade is 16 ounces (453 g). The M67 grenade is 14 ounces (397 g). The MK2 grenade is 21 ounces (595 g). The No. 5 Mark I Mills grenade is 22.5 ounces (638 g).
